F.E.A.R
Fernando felt a chill sprinting down his spine,
He held something in his hand,
And that something was mine.
Sweat trickled down his back,
Drop by drop on the floor.
He was escorted by my assistant,
Who then knocked on the door.
“Enter” I said, the handle turned slowly,
Revealing his face, which seemed a bit lowly.
I asked him “Why so sad?” with a smirk and a snigger,
I picked up the gun,
And wrapped my finger round the trigger.
I pointed it straight at his forehead,
I played with his life before he lay in his resting bed.
A ring was handed to me,
One that he stole a while ago.
It felt weird holding something given by a foe.
Then I figured why, he had given me a gimmick!
That made things only worse for Fernando,
Because that, made me sick.
BANG! He dropped dead, unworthy to be picked.
Red was his blood that he lay in,
But he lied to me, that is a sin.
Although, he did not fear consequence,
He had no FEAR within.
